New LRG method enhances imbalanced time series classification

Researchers have developed a new method called Local Reference Geometry (LRG) to improve imbalanced time series classification. This technique addresses a failure in learned feature spaces where minority class data points can become isolated or mixed within sparse neighborhoods, even if global class structure is preserved. LRG acts as a post-hoc augmentation module, analyzing local feature geometry and class mixture risk to add a standardized displacement to existing features, thereby enhancing representation reliability around minority regions.
